Need help with 05 crf450r valve clearence!


Im trying to figure out my valve clearence because my bike wont start easily if at all. Im a 2 stroke guy that just went 4 and i know that the bike has been gone over from top to bottom about 2 months before i bought it. The valves are steel aftermarkets that shouldnt be worn out by now. I need to figure out the intake valve clearence but i cant even get a .0015" feeler gauge in there and the clearence should be .006" +-.001". If anyone can walk me through it or tell me what i am doing or what else might be the problem it would be much appreciated.
